About Southern Highlands Community Mental Health Center Princeton Clinic
Southern Highlands Community Mental Health Center Princeton Clinic is a trusted provider of outpatient addiction treatment in Princeton, West Virginia serving as a key access point into a broader recovery system.
While the organization offers a full continuum of care including residential programs, crisis stabilization and detox coordination, the Princeton Clinic focuses on accessible outpatient services and medication assisted treatment.
Operating since 1968, the nonprofit helps clients build a stable foundation for long term recovery close to home.
Addiction Treatment and MAT
The Princeton Clinic provides outpatient substance use treatment for adults struggling with opioid, alcohol, stimulant, prescription medication and polysubstance use including those with co-occurring mental health conditions.
Office based medication assisted treatment is available with Suboxone, Vivitrol and same day MAT induction options offered through the broader service line.
Clients can expect a mix of individual counseling, group therapy, case management and peer recovery support, guided by evidence based approaches such as cognitive behavioral therapy and motivational interviewing, the Matrix Model and relapse prevention.
Life skills training, trauma related counseling and AA/NA participation further reinforce sustainable recovery.

Payment Options
Beyond outpatient care, the Princeton Clinic connects clients to psychiatric evaluation, medication management and telehealth, DUI education and gender specific residential tracks within the wider network.
Integrated dual diagnosis care supports clients with both mental health and substance use needs.
As a Certified Community Behavioral Health Clinic, Southern Highlands accepts West Virginia Medicaid, Medicare Part B, and major private insurers including Aetna, Cigna and Highmark BCBS.
A sliding fee scale and financial assistance ensure no one is turned away for inability to pay.
